Hyundai Kona Electric 2022

Hyundai unveiled a restyled version of the 2022 Kona Electric crossover for the U.S. market, which received exterior and interior design updates.

The most striking and expressive change has touched the front of the electric car, in which the former false grille panel with shallow recesses has disappeared, instead of which now a smooth, minimalist surface. The geometry of the air intake pattern of the front bumper has changed, the Hyundai logo has been moved higher on the hood, there is a distinctive cover of the charging port of the electric car.

The Hyundai Kona Electric 2022 got a new wheel design that optimizes airflow and a redesigned rear bumper. The electric car’s front and rear LED optics have also changed.

Not as much has changed inside the model as outside, including new 10.25-inch dashboard and multimedia system displays and wireless charging at the bottom of the center console. However, the larger displays have made the entire interior of the electric crossover noticeably more cheerful.

The electric car has added safety and offers rear-end collision avoidance, intelligent cruise control, and a new Highway Drive Assist feature that can help keep the vehicle in the center of the lane at a given distance from the lead vehicle and even make adjustments to speed limits on highways.

Otherwise, the Kona Electric for the U.S. market retains the same specs: a 150 kW (201 hp) powertrain and a 64 kW⋅h lithium-ion battery pack.
